I had a rear head gasket leaking externally and also a bit of oil in the radiator overflow tank.Don't know if the 2 are separate issues but I started by pulling the heads and #3 cylinder has some bad scoring on the top of the bore. Bike ran great I just want to fix it right and need some advice. Thanks
 
Does the head gasket show signs of failure? Did you do a compression or leakdown test before disassembly?l
 
Best bet is to post a few pics, include the head if you can. I'd think there is definitely a connection between the oil in the water and blown head gasket. The head should be checked for warping and cracks. If you're not acquainted with Sean Morley, it's time. Most likely this will interest him as well as others. How many miles on the bike? Has it been apart before?
 
Sorry it took so long to reply but I'm still trying to figure this sight out. I did'nt do a compression test prior to disassembly. Center 2 head bolts seemed loose and there was only slight oil leak in that area. I purchased the bike with 10k on it and not running. Was told it needed carbs cleaned but turned out to be pick up coil wires were cut and corroded were they pass through a metal loom. Head gasket looks good along with deck surface. Scratches appear to be too deep to hone out but are only at the top and bottom of the stroke. Maybe they flogged it with starting fluid trying to start it with no spark- just a guess.I'll try and get some pics up. Does anyone have contact info for Sean Morley? Thanks for all the help.
